The Drivers<br />

JOHN BOURASSA<br />

JON bor-AH-sah<br />

Hope Sound, Fla.<br />

Age: 61<br />

2008: Raced in seven events. Season high finish was 14th at both Sebring<br />

and Road America.<br />

Previously: Began ice racing in 1963 on road courses on frozen lakes in<br />

Canada. Competed in <strong>the</strong> His<strong>to</strong>ric Sportscar Racing GT Drivers’ Championship<br />

from 1991-2003, as well as having raced in Speedvision Cup, Mo<strong>to</strong>rola Cup,<br />

and Grand-Am Cup. Has numerous race wins and poduim finishes throughout<br />

his career. In 2003, as a rookie, competed in four SPEED GT races and<br />

scored a career-best 12th place finish at Road America. In 2004, his second<br />

season, ran a career-high nine events, missing only Laguna at <strong>the</strong> end <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> season. Earned three<br />

Top-20 finishes in second season, with best finish (15th) coming at Infineon. In 2005, finished in<br />

<strong>the</strong> <strong>to</strong>p-20 in eight <strong>of</strong> nine races. Entered eight races in 2006 with a Porsche 911 Tubro. Best result<br />

was 15th at Road America. Enter Porsche 911 Turbo in six 2007 races, starting <strong>the</strong> season with his<br />

highest finish, 15th, at Sebring.<br />

Personal: Born May 9, 1947, is married <strong>to</strong> Pauli and has two children (Andre and James). He is a<br />

land developer and builder. Enjoys Blues music and Indian food. Drives a Mercedes S500 on <strong>the</strong><br />

street. His racing hereos include Senna and Hans Stuck; favorite track is Watkins Glen.<br />

RICK BOYSAL (R)<br />

RICK BOY-s<strong>all</strong><br />

Danville, Calif.<br />

Age: 48<br />

Previously: Started racing in 2000 and has since collected numerous SCCA<br />

Regional Championships including <strong>the</strong> 2001 Pacific Coast Championship and<br />

<strong>the</strong> 2002 Rose Cup driving a Chevrolet Corvette in <strong>the</strong> T1 class. Went SPEED<br />

GT racing at Laguna Seca, driving his T1 Corvette in 2002. Returned in a<br />

Corvette for 2003 SPEED GT season opener at Sebring. Plans <strong>to</strong> pilot a<br />

Corvette CR6 for <strong>the</strong> 2009 SPEED GT season.<br />

Personal: Born May 28, 1960. Is <strong>the</strong> CEO <strong>of</strong> a real estate development company<br />

and drives a Corvette Z06 on <strong>the</strong> street. Is married <strong>to</strong> Shannon with<br />

three children (Corey, Shelly and Chloe). Enjoys Law & Order and sushi. Lists Laguna Seca as his<br />

favorite track and Michael Schumacher as his racing hero.<br />

PAUL BROWN<br />

PAUL BROWN<br />

Covina, Calif.<br />

Age: 39<br />

2008: Entered first two rounds <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> SPEED GT season in a Porsche 911<br />

GT3, finishing 10th at Sebring and 20th at Long Beach.<br />

Previously: Started SCCA Club Racing in 1992. Has served as a Ford Mo<strong>to</strong>r<br />

Company Tier 4 test driver and Aero Racing USA (Morgan) fac<strong>to</strong>ry test driver.<br />

In 1993 finished eighth in first SCCA Pro Race, racing a Ford Mustang<br />

Cobra at Des Moines in <strong>the</strong> WC Class. Earned a <strong>to</strong>tal <strong>of</strong> 12 <strong>to</strong>p-10 and four<br />

<strong>to</strong>p-five finishes in <strong>World</strong> Ch<strong>all</strong>enge between 1993 and 1998. Best<br />

Championship finish came in 1998 when he finished sixth. Ended <strong>the</strong> year<br />

seventh in <strong>the</strong> 1999 SPEED GT Championship with four <strong>to</strong>p-10 finishes and a career-high secondplace<br />

at Vancouver, driving a Ford Saleen Mustang. In 2000, earned <strong>to</strong>p-10 finishes at Lowes Mo<strong>to</strong>r<br />

Speedway, Lime Rock Park and Ste. Croix behind <strong>the</strong> wheel <strong>of</strong> a Saleen SR. Enter two events in<br />

2001 with a Chevrolet Corvette, finishing 15th at Sebring and 14th at Road Atlanta. Finished 11th<br />

in <strong>the</strong> 2004 Le Mans His<strong>to</strong>ric 24 Hours driving a 1971 Ferrari 512 M. Was a winner at <strong>the</strong> 2005<br />

Monterey His<strong>to</strong>rics in a 1961 Chaparral 1. In 2006 won <strong>the</strong> first-ever NASA American Iron Extreme<br />

national race.<br />

Personal: Born July 8, 1965. Married <strong>to</strong> <strong>World</strong> Ch<strong>all</strong>enge veteran Carol Hollfelder. Is <strong>the</strong> race shop<br />

manager for Tiger Racing, but first job was as a Skip Barber mechanic. Drives a Ford Mustang GT<br />

on <strong>the</strong> street. Enjoys a good steak and <strong>the</strong> TV show Top Gear. Road America is his favorite track<br />

and Brian Redman is his racing hero.<br />
